Preston D. Jaquish is an associate of McGrath McCall, P.C. Preston focuses his practice in representing financial institutions in a wide variety of transaction and litigation matters including commercial real estate transaction and documentation, loan workouts, commercial and residential foreclosures, creditors’ rights in bankruptcy and various other matters.
Preston is licensed to practice before the Supreme Court of Pennsylvania and the United States District Court for the Western District of Pennsylvania.
​
Preston obtained his J.D. from the University of Pittsburgh School of Law in 2013. While at Pitt, Mr. Jaquish served as Topics Editor for the Pittsburgh Journal of Environmental and Public Health Law. Mr. Jaquish also participated in the Pittsburgh Family Law Clinic where he represented clients on family law matters by preparing motions, arguing said motions before the Allegheny County Court of Common Pleas, and negotiating settlements. Preston was the 2013 recipient of the Eric D. Turner Award issued by the American Academy of Matrimonial Lawyers (Pennsylvania Chapter).
​
Preston graduated from Lock Haven University of Pennsylvania in 2008 with a B.A. in Political Science. While at Lock Haven, Mr. Jaquish was a four-year member of the nationally ranked NCAA Division II Cross Country team, and was named co-captain for the 2007 season.
